The Roofing System Substitute Refine: What to Expect From Start to Finish Recognizing the roof covering substitute process is crucial for home owners considering this substantial financial investment. Each stage, from the preliminary assessment of your roof covering's problem to the precise setup of new products, plays a vital role https://a1-roofing72592.amoblog.com/licensed-roofing-contractor-for-expert-repairs-and-maintenance-52873568